Preparing Your Home for the Market
Selling your home in Saguaro Park starts with ensuring it’s in its best condition to appeal to potential buyers. Here’s a strategic approach:
1. Conducting a Property Inspection
Before you list your home, arrange for a professional inspection. This step is crucial as it identifies any necessary repairs or improvements. Addressing these issues beforehand increases the likelihood of a smooth sale and minimizes unexpected costs post-listing.
2. Enhancing Curb Appeal
First impressions matter! Invest in improving your home’s curb appeal:
- Landscaping: Well-maintained landscaping, including fresh mulch and vibrant flowers or plants, can significantly enhance the exterior look of your property.
- Exterior Paint: A new coat of paint on the outside of your home not only boosts aesthetics but also protects against Arizona’s intense sun.
- Entrance Way: Consider sprucing up your entrance way with new doormats and lighting to create a warm welcome for potential buyers.
3. Stage Your Home for Maximum Impact
Staging is an effective way to showcase your home’s best features and help buyers envision themselves living there:
- De-clutter: Start by decluttering every room, focusing on minimalism and organization. Consider temporarily storing items that are out of place or excessive.
- Neutral Decor: Opt for neutral colors and decor pieces that complement a variety of buyer tastes. Avoid bold personal statements that may not appeal to all viewers.
- Enhance Natural Light: Open blinds and curtains to let in natural light, making spaces appear larger and brighter.
4. Update Key Areas
Certain areas of your home have a significant impact on buyers’ perceptions:
- Kitchen: The heart of any home, updating kitchen appliances, countertops, and cabinets can make a substantial difference in its appeal. Consider modern trends while staying true to the style of your home.
- Bathrooms: Freshen up bathroom tiles, fixtures, and vanities to create a spa-like atmosphere. These upgrades are highly visible and can add significant value.
- Master Suite: Make the master bedroom inviting and luxurious. Update bedding, curtains, and lighting to create a tranquil retreat.

Navigating the Sales Process
Handling Viewings and Showings
Once your listing is active, be prepared to accommodate viewings and showings:
- Stay Flexible: Be available for showings during convenient times to accommodate busy schedules of potential buyers.
- Preparation: Ensure your home remains tidy between viewings, and consider having a "showings only" cleaning checklist to maintain consistency.
- Greet Visitors Warmly: A friendly greeting can put buyers at ease and create a positive first impression.
Negotiation and Acceptance
The sales process in Saguaro Park, like many other markets, involves negotiation:
- Listen to Offers: Carefully consider each offer received, taking into account the buyer’s financing, inspection reports, and any contingencies.
- Negotiate Strategically: Don’t be afraid to negotiate, but do so respectfully. Focus on points that are negotiable, such as closing costs or certain repairs, rather than the asking price itself.
- Acceptance: Once you’ve agreed on terms with a buyer, prepare for the next steps, including legal documentation and final inspections.
Closing the Deal
Closing is the culmination of your efforts:
- Documentation: Work closely with your real estate agent and attorney to ensure all necessary paperwork is completed accurately and on time.
- Inspection: Schedule a final inspection to confirm that the property is in the same condition as when the buyer agreed to purchase it.
- Funding: Ensure funds are secured by the closing date. Once all parties have signed the necessary documents, the sale will be finalized.

How long does it typically take to sell a home in Saguaro Park?
The timeline for selling a home can vary depending on market conditions and the specific property. In a hot market like Surprise, well-priced homes often receive multiple offers within days or weeks of listing. From there, the sales process generally takes 30-60 days, including negotiations, inspections, and paperwork.
